The combination of the Stimulus-Organism-Response (SOR) model with a quantitative research method - a broad survey of 244 consumers living in Hanoi, Vietnam. The authors aim to demonstrate the influence of Blockchain's traceability on consumers' intention to purchase food products. Through analysis using SPSS 26.0, the research results indicated that Blockchain traceability enhanced food quality, safety, and food fraud prevention, consequently had a positive impact on consumer trust and purchase intention. Based on these findings, the authors provided recommendations for authorities and businesses to promote the application of Blockchain in enhancing consumer trust and purchase intention.
